Transaction 3433c940506021b682dea8a79c04a1403cf2fa7821a1582e852195eb7c5e4fa4
1 Input
1 Output
-
3433c940506021b682dea8a79c04a1403cf2fa7821a1582e852195eb7c5e4fa4:0
- value
- 549044
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e931d742118d09a8bc6490a2165fab75380a8500 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NG29haQkbECQgNfqH75Ce1SDUrCf74Z4P